> > Michał Górny <mgorny@gentoo.org> wrote:
> > > +# 1.2b-alpha4 -> 1 . 2 '' b - alpha '' 4
> >
> > Is this only to explain the syntax or are there plans to
> > extend the allowed versions for pms?
>
> It only explains how the functions parse stuff (except for ver_test
> which uses PMS rules). They are by definition supposed to work with
> random upstream versions.
This sounds like the sort of thing that could go horribly wrong... I
didn't design versionator to work with arbitrary messy stuff since the
main use is in manipulating Gentoo PV versions. Where are these other
versions coming from?
